The global industrial coatings paradigm is transitioning rapidly from traditional solvent-borne systems toward radiation-curable (UV/EB) technologies. As regulatory pressures surrounding Volatile Organic Compound (VOC) emissions tighten globally, procurement managers and formulators require raw materials that deliver not only compliance but superior physical characteristics.
Currently, the demand for Cure UV Resin oligomers is driven by the explosive growth in high-speed, high-resolution printing, micro-electronics packaging, automotive interior coatings, and sustainable packaging. Advanced oligomers, such as modified epoxy acrylates and polycarbonate acrylates, act as the backbone of these formulations. They dictate the ultimate coating properties: crosslinking density, polymerization rate, chemical resistance, flexibility, and substrate adhesion.

Matching the right molecular design with demanding application environments.
Our Aromatic PA UV-resins (like 7113A and 7160) deliver excellent adhesion to treated and untreated plastics (PC, ABS, PMMA) and are designed for primer/basecoat application in thermal and sputtering vacuum metallization layers.
Our specialty 53036 Polyester Acrylate is formulated for excimer laser matting (172nm), producing a super-matte, scratch-resistant surface with an exceptional soft touch / skin feel for premium consumer products.
Polyester acrylates (such as 5403-2F and 5218) offer excellent pigment wetting properties, stable rheology, and minimized misting on high-speed offset, flexographic, and screen-printing presses.
Our research division focuses on two major technology fronts: Bio-based Carbon Content and Dual-Cure Systems. Over the next three years, Ever Ray plans to introduce renewable raw materials into our aliphatic polyurethane acrylate chains, increasing the bio-based content of the oligomer structure to over 35% without degrading cure speed or surface hardness.
Additionally, to resolve line-of-sight curing limitations on three-dimensional substrates, we are refining our moisture/UV dual-cure and thermal/UV dual-cure systems. These developments ensure that shadowed areas on complex automotive parts or electronic assemblies achieve complete cure over time.
